In this case, we will keep the first index, 1, fixed and then ... WebA partial permutation is an ordering of only k objects selected from a collection of n objects ( k ≤ n ). For example, a partial permutation of 3 of the first 8 positive integers is given by ( 5, 7, 2). The statistic P ( n, k) counts the total number of possible partial permutations of k objects chosen from a collection of n objects.
